Galaxy number counts and Fractal correlations
– We report the correlation analysis of various redshift surveys which shows that the available data are consistent with each other and manifest fractal correlations (with dimension D ≃ 2) up to the present observational limits (≈ 150hMpc) without any tendency towards homogenization. This result points to a new interpretation of the number counts that represents the main subject of this letter....

متن کاملFuture Singularities of Isotropic Cosmologies
We show that globally and regularly hyperbolic future geodesically incomplete isotropic universes, except for the standard all-encompassing ‘big crunch’, can accommodate singularities of only one kind, namely, those having a non-integrable Hubble parameter, H.
